Abstract
고순도의 수산화제 4급암모늄수용액을 제조하는 방법을 제공하는 것으로서 제4급암모늄유기산염을 과산화수소, 산소 또는 산소함유가스를 백금족금속촉매의 존재하에 반응시켜서 제4급암모늄기산염을 제조하고, 이것을 양이온 교환막을 갖는 전해탱크를 사용해서 전해하는 것을 특징으로 하는 고순도의 수산화제4급암모늄수용액을 제조방법을 제시하는 것이다.

Claims (9)
- 일반식(I)[단, 식중 R1~R4는 탄소수 1~3의 알킬기를 나타내고, 그들은 동일하거나 달라도 된다. X는 유기산기를 나타낸다]로 표시되는 제4급암모늄유기산염의 수용액을 백금족금속촉매의 존재하에 과산화수소, 산소 또는 산소함유가스와 반응시켜서 제4급암모늄무기산염을 합성하고, 그 제4급암모늄무기산염수용액을 전해하는 것을 특징으로 하는 수산화제4급암모늄수용액을 제조방법.
- 제1항에 있어서, 제4급암모늄유기산염이 테트라메틸암모늄포름산염 또는 테트라에틸암모늄포름산염인 것을 특징으로 하는 수산화제4급암모늄수용액의 제조방법.
- 제1항에 있어서, 제4급암모늄유기산염과 과산화수소, 산소 또는 산소함유가스중의 산소와의 몰비가 0.5~100인 것을 특징으로 하는 수산화제4급암모늄수용액의 제조방법.
- 제3항에 있어서, 제4급암모늄유기산염과 과산화수소와의 몰비는 1~20인 것을 특징으로 하는 수산화제4급암모늄수용액의 제조방법.
- 제1항에 있어서, 백금족금속이 피라듐, 백금, 루테늄, 로듐 및 이리듐으로부터 선택된 적어도 1종인 것을 특징으로 하는 수산화제4급암모늄수용액의 제조방법.
- 제1항에 있어서, 백금족금속촉매는 백금족금속이 담체에 대해 0.01~20중량% 담지된 촉매인것을 특징으로 하는 수산화제4급암모늄수용액의 제조방법.
- 제6항에 있어서, 담체가 활성탄, 탄소섬유, 활성탄소섬유등의 탄소계담체; 실리카, 알루미나, 실리카-알루미나 및 제올라이트의 무기계담체로부터 선택된 담체인 것을 특징으로 하는 수산화제4급암모늄수용액의 제조방법.
- 제1항에 있어서, 전해에 있어서 양극실에 공급되는 제4급암모늄무기산염수용액의 농도가 1~60중량%인 것을 특징으로 하는 수산화제4급암모늄수용액의 제조방법.
- 제1항에 있어서, 제4급암모늄무기산염을 합성하는 반응온도가 10~200℃인 것을 특징으로 하는 수산화제4급암모늄수용액의 제조방법.※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.
